Output 7f8c12922bd0c33105a4f2aff9471a3431947af4c79564368de760f39a64406e:0

value
147860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de58bb07adc2b5763f3e71d9d0026cb003041865 OP_EQUAL
address
3MxgEEqFcJWskNVt8FDu9MDMXrmUmiqcLc
transaction
7f8c12922bd0c33105a4f2aff9471a3431947af4c79564368de760f39a64406e
spent
true